Fausta (wife of Constantine I) BI Nummus. London, AD 325. FLAV MAX FAVSTA AG, mantled bust to right / SALVS REIPVBLICAE, Empress, draped and veiled, standing to left, holding two children in arms; PLON in exergue. RIC VII 300; CT 10.02.011. 3.57g, 19mm, 6h.

Extremely Fine; an attractive specimen.

From the Richard Stirk Collection;
Acquired from Den of Antiquity Ltd, dealer's ticket included.
